When should I stay at a B&B in Volcano?
When you’re planning your escape to Volcano, year-round temperatures and rainfall may be important factors to consider. The hottest months are usually October and September, with an average temperature of 23°C, while the coldest months are February and March, with an average of 20°C. Average annual precipitation for Volcano is 1522 mm.

How can I get to and around Volcano?
You can plan your excursions in and around Volcano ahead of time with these transportation options. Fly into Hilo, HI (ITO-Hilo Intl.), which is located 23.5 mi (37.8 km) from the city centre. If you’d like to explore around the area, consider renting a car to explore more sights.
